Drone forensics in law enforcement: Assessing utilisation, challenges, and emerging necessities
The proliferation of drone technology has introduced new challenges and opportunities for law enforcement, necessitating the development of drone forensics as a specialised field within digital forensics. This survey paper explores the critical role of drone forensics in modern policing, focusing on its applications in investigating crimes involving un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s) and addressing emerging security threats. This paper examines the tools, data extraction methods, and operational practices employed in drone forensic investigations, with particular attention to cases of unauthorised surveillance, smuggling, and cyber-attacks. Furthermore, this study discusses the technical, legal, and ethical challenges associated with drone forensics, including encryption, anti-forensic techniques, proprietary software, and privacy concerns. Through a synthesis of current practices, technological advancements, and relevant case studies, this survey provides insights into the effectiveness, limitations, and evolving needs of drone forensics. Recommendations are offered to enhance law enforcement capabilities, emphasising the importance of continuous training, standardised protocols, and collaboration across agencies. This survey paper aims to support policymakers, law enforcement agencies, and forensic practitioners in integrating drone forensics as a versatile and effective approach for safeguarding public safety and ensuring justice in an increasingly drone-integrated world.
